What is 99/50 Divided By 9/5

Answer: 9950÷95\frac{99}{50}\div\frac{9}{5} = 1110\frac{11}{10}

Solving 9950÷95\frac{99}{50}\div\frac{9}{5}

  • Rewrite the Division as Multiplication by the Reciprocal:

9950÷95=9950×59\frac{99}{50} \div \frac{9}{5} = \frac{99}{50} \times \frac{5}{9}

  • Multiply the Numerators: 99×5=49599 \times 5 = 495
  • Multiply the Denominators: 50×9=45050 \times 9 = 450
  • Form the New Fraction: 9950×95=495450\frac{99}{50} \times \frac{9}{5} = \frac{495}{450}

Let's Simplify 495450\frac{495}{450}

  • Find the Greatest Common Divisor (GCD) of 495495 and 450450. The GCD of 495495 and 450450 is 4545.
  • Divide both the numerator and the denominator by the GCD:495÷45450÷45=1110\frac{495 \div 45}{450 \div 45} = \frac{11}{10}

Answer 9950÷95=1110\frac{99}{50}\div\frac{9}{5} = \frac{11}{10}
